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
kursah.docx
Скачиваний:
10
Добавлен:
02.02.2015
Размер:
413.82 Кб
Скачать

Моделювання схеми к155ие2 в серидовищі Microcap 9.0

Моделювання схеми

ЛИСТ ЗАТВЕРДЖЕННЯ

КІТ 10а.10008-10 12 1-01 ЛЗ

Керівник проекту:

_______________ Калашніков В.І.

«___»________________2013р.

Виконавець:

Студент групи КІТ 10б

________________Гончаренко А.К.

«___» ________________2013 р.

Харків 2013

ЗАТВЕРДЖЕНО

КІТ 10б.10025-10 12 1-01 ЛЗ

Моделювання схеми к155ие2 в серидовищі Microcap 9.0

Моделювання схеми

КІТ 10б.10025-10 12 1-01

Листів 10

Харків 2013

-2-

КІТ 10б.10025-10 12 1-01

АНОТАЦІЯ

У даному документі находяться відомості про процес ознайомлення з програмою Microcap 9 і схемою лічильника К155 ИЕ2 згідно з технічним завданням КІТ 10б.10025-10 90 1-01, виданим на курсове проектування. Подається функціональне призначення програми Microcap, опис лычильника, структурна схема, а також опис характеру і організації вхідних та вихідних даних.

АННОТАЦИЯ

        В данном документе находятся сведения о процессе ознакомления с программой Microcap 9 и схеме счетчика К155 ИЕ2 согласно техническому заданию КИТ 10б.10025-10 90 1-01, выданным на курсовое проектирование. Подается функциональное назначение программы Microcap, описание лычильника, структурная схема, а также описание характера и организации входных и выходных данных.

-3-

КІТ 10б.10025-10 13 1-01

ЗМІСТ

1 Опис програми……………………………………………………………...…...4

2 Опис лічильника К155ИЕ2………………………………………….…….…....5

3 Моделювання схеми…………………………………………………..….…......7

4 Аналіз результатів………………………………………………………...…..10

-4-

КІТ 10б.10025-10 13 1-01

  1. Опис програми

Програма MicroCap 9.0 5.0 Evaluation version є вільно поширюваною демоверсією професійної програми машинного моделювання електронних схем (Www.spectrum-soft.com), але вона володіє практично всіма якісними можливостями повнофункціональної, а обмеження носять здебільшого кількісний характер (демоверсія дозволяє моделювати схеми, число компонентів в яких не перевищує 50, розрахунки ряду схем проходять кілька повільніше, ніж у повнофункціональної версії, обмежена бібліотека компонентів, немає вбудованої програми підготовки власних моделей і деяких інших додаткових функцій).

У програму вставлений досить докладний розділ HELP, а на сайті розробника можна отримати додаткові матеріали, наприклад файл «DemoRead.doc". На російською мовою існує книга: М. А. Амеліна, С. А. Амелін. Програма схемотехнічного моделювання Micro-Cap 8. Москва, Гаряча лінія - Телеком, 2007.

Ця програма дозволяє почати моделювання електричних ланцюгів новачкові навіть без глибокого її вивчення. Для наших цілей немає необхідності досконального вивчення програми, тому знайомство з необхідними функціями ми будемо здійснювати безпосередньо при виконанні конкретних завдань. Інтерфейс програми є стандартним для програм ОС Windows. Як звичайно, всі команди можна викликати через меню, частина найбільш вживаних виведена на інструментальні панелі у вигляді ярличків (піктограм). Призначення стандартних піктограм (,, і т. п.) не розглядаємо, тому що вони досить добре відомі навіть недосвідченому користувачу.

Користувач становить електричний ланцюг безпосередньо в зручному графічному редакторі (Circuit editor), потім задає параметри аналізу ланцюга (Analysis) і вивчає графіки з даними. Програма автоматично складає рівняння для даної ланцюга і виробляє їх математичний розрахунок. При завантаженні програми з'являється головне вікно MAIN, готове для малювання електричної схеми в новому файлі, які отримують назву за замовчуванням circuit1.cir. Випадають нотатки дня (Tip of the day) можна прибрати після ознайомлення. У розділі FAIL ми бачимо звичайні для ОС Windows команди для роботи з файлами. Створені файли електричних ланцюгів ми зберігатимемо в типі Schematic (*. Cir). Решта команд нас поки не цікавлять.

-5-

КІТ 10б.10025-10 13 1-01

  1. Опис лічильника К155ИЕ2

Умовне графічне позначення  1 - вхід лічильний С2; 2 - вхід установки 0 R0(1); 3 - вхід установки 0 R0(2); 4,13 - вільні; 5 - напруга живлення +Uп; 6 - вхід установки 9 R9(1); 7 - вхід установки 9 R9(2); 8 - вихід Q3; 9 - вихід Q2; 10 - загальний; 11 - вихід Q4; 12 - вихід Q1; 14 - вхід лічильний C1;  Функціональна схема  

-6-

КІТ 10б.10025-10 13 1-01

Электричні параметри

1

Номинальна напруга живлення

5 В 5 %

2

Вихідна напруга низького рівня при Uп=4,75 В

не більше 0,4 В

3

Вихідна напруга високого рівня при Uп=4,75 В

не менше 2,4 В

4

Напруга на антизвонному діоді при Uп=4,75 В

не менше-1,5 В

5

Вхідной струм низького рівня по входам установки 0 и 9 при Uп=5,25 В

не більше -1,6 мА

6

Вхідной струм низького рівня по лічильному входу С1 при Uп=5,25 В

не більше -3,2 мА

7

Вхідной струм низького рівня по лічильному входу С2 при Uп=5,25 В

не більше -6,4 мА

8

Вхідной струм високого рівня по входам установки 0 и 9 при Uп=5,25 В

не більше -0,04 мА

9

Входной ток высокого уровня по счетному входу С1 при Uп=5,25 В

не більше 0,08 мА

10

Вхідной струм високого рівня по лічильному входу С2 при Uп=5,25 В

не більше 0,16 мА

11

Струм вхідного пробивної напруги по входам установки 0 та 9 з лічильними входами С1 и С2

не більше 0,1 мА

12

Струм споживання

не більше 53 мА

13

Час затримки розповсюдження при включенні по лічильному входу С1 при Uп=5 В

не більше 100 нс

14

Час затримки розповсюдження при виключенні по лічильному входу С1 при Uп=5 В

не більше 100 нс

Мікросхеми К155ИЕ2 і КМ155ИЕ2 (7490) чотирьохрозрядний десятковий асинхронний лічильник пульсацій. Внутрішня схема його показана на малюнку. Перший тригер лічильника може працювати самостійно. Він служить дільником вхідної частоти в 2 рази, Тактовий вхід цього дільника C1, а вихід Q1. Інші три тригера утворюють дільник на 5. Тактовий вхід тут C2. Для обох тактових входів запускає перепад негативний, тобто від високого рівня до низького.

Лічильник має два входи R для синхронного скидання, а також два синхронних входу S для попереднього завантаження на лічильник двійкового коду 1001, відповідного десяткового цифрі 9. Оскільки лічильник К155ІЕ2, КМ155ІЕ2 (7490) асинхронний, стану на його виходах Q1 – Q4 не можуть

-7-

КІТ 10б.10025-10 13 1-01

змінюватися одночасно. Якщо-після даного лічильника вихідний код, потрібно дешифрировать, тобто перевести його в десяткове число, дешифратор повинен стробіроватьея на час цієї операції. Інакше через неодночасність перемикання вихідних рівнів чотирьох тригерів можуть дешифрувати імпульсні перешкоди.

Входи синхронного скидання R0(двухвходового елемент І) забороняють дію імпульсів по обом тактовим входів і входів установки R9. Імпульс, поданий на вхід R, дає скидання даних по всіх триггерам одночасно. Подачею напруги на входи R9 забороняється проходження на лічильник тактових імпульсів, а також сигналів від входів R0. На виходах лічильника Q1 – Q4 встановлюються напруги вихідних рівнів ВННВ, що відповідає коду 1001, тобто цифрі 9.

Щоб отримати на виходах лічильника К155ИЕ2, КМ155ИЕ2 (7490) двійковій-десятковий код з вагою двійкових розрядів 8-4-2-1, необхідно з'єднати вихід Q1 і вхід С2. Вхідна послідовність подається на тактовий вхід С1 . Симетричний лічильник-дільник вхідної частоти в 10 разів вийде, якщо з'єднати вихід Q4 з вхід C1. Симетричний спосіб розподілу в зарубіжній літературі називається bi-quinary, тобто в перекладі - дві п'ятірки. Вихідна послідовність за рахунку двома п'ятірками має вигляд симетричного меандру з зменшеною в 10 разів частотою. Знімається вона з виходу Q1 мікросхеми К155ИЕ2 КМ155ИЕ2 (7490).

Для розподілу частоти на два використовується тактовий вхід С1 і вихід Q1. Для розподілу частоти в 5 разів подаємо вхідну послідовність на виведення 1. Вихідний сигнал отримуємо на виході Q4, Зовнішні перемички для цих простих дільників не потрібні. Лічильник К155ИЕ2, КМ155ИЕ2 (аналог 7490) має струм споживання 53 мА і максимальну тактову частоту 10 МГц. Аналогічна схема варіанту 74LS 90 споживає струм 15 мА і має тактову частоту до 30 МГц.

Режим роботи лічильника К155ИЕ2, КМ155ИЕ2 (7490) можна вибрати з таблиці (скидання вихідних даних в нуль, установка, тобто завантаження дев'ятки, рахунок). У таблиці показана послідовність зміни напруг високих і низьких рівнів на виходах лічильника К155ІЕ2 і КМ155ІЕ2 (7490) в режимі двійковій-десяткового рахунку, коли потрібно з'єднати зовнішньої перемичкою вихід Q1 і вхід С2 (тобто висновки 1 і 12).

Закордонним аналогом мікросхеми КМ155ІЕ2 є мікросхема 7490.

  1. Моделювання схеми

    1. Для побудови схеми нам знадобляться:

  • 2 елементи NAND;

  • 1 елемент AND;

  • 3 джерела STIM1;

  • 4 JK-тригери;

-8-

КІТ 10б.10025-10 13 1-01

      1. окремих джерела нам необхідні для полегшення подачі сигналів Set і Reset. Хоча в реальній схемі доцільніше використовувати 1 STIM4.

      2. 4 JK-тригери нам необхідно зібрати з базових елементів, тому ми створюємо макрос триггера, щоб схема виглядала наглядніше.

    1. Створюємо макрос:

Схема макросу – рис.3.2:

Рисунок 3.2 – Схема JK-тригера

Часова діаграмма – Рис-3.2.1:

Рисунок 3.2.1 – Результат моделювання JK-тригера

    1. Установки для лічильника :

      1. Для С0:

-9-

КІТ 10б.10025-10 13 1-01

.define _1M

+0ns 1

+label=start

+500n 0

+1u 1

+1500n goto start -1 times

      1. Для R:

.define _1MH

+0ns 1

+5u 0

+10u 1

+15u 0

      1. Для S:

.define _1MHz

+0u 0

+5500n 1

+9500n 0

    1. Будуємо схему. Побудована схема – рис. 3.4.:

Рисунок 3.4. – Схема лічильника К155ИЕ2

    1. Одержані результати моделювання – рис 3.5.:

-10-

КІТ 10б.10025-10 13 1-01

Рисунок 3.5. – Часова діаграмма промодельованої схеми

  1. Аналіз результатів

На вхід схеми ми подаємо спочатку скидання, потім установку «1-ці», потім знову зкидання, и лище потім схема повинна почати працювати.

Проте вихід Q3 зовсым не реагує, інші видають не ті результати.

Скоріш за все пояснюється неправильною схемою JK-тригера або помилками у переданні схеми.

Також слід відмітити те, що головною задачею було освоєння програми Microcap 9.0, з якою студент впорався. Також це пояснюється важкістю знаходження потрібної схеми JK-тригера.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]